About Jayne
Jayne loves to interact with people. She has worked as a community tutor teaching Patchwork & Quilting and Soft Furnishings at various venues. Prior to this she spent 10 years making handmade footwear.
Jayne is now regional sales & education manager for Janome UK and works across the South of England.
Her role at Janome is a very varied role with no two days being the same. You may well see her at sewing machine retail shop open days promoting Janome machines as well as at exhibitions demonstrating the extensive range of Janome machines.
Jayne is an expert at helping people understand what machine is right for them, as well as teaching how to make innovative stitches on their sewing machine, opening up a whole new world of creativity.

Top Tips
- Buy a sewing machine that will grow with you as your skills develop.
- Make sure to clean and maintain your machine regularly. This will ensure that it is a good working condition every time you sew.
- Use the correct needles for your sewing project and change them regularly.
- Use a good quality thread and always buy the correct bobbins for your machine.

Rail Fence -what happens when I use more fabrics?
Here is a comment from one of our viewers: Made your rail fence with 4 strips but the pattern did not work out for 2 reasons. Firstly my dominant colour was second so didn't make the zigzag pattern. Secondly I used 2 similar fabrics so they got lost.
It would be helpful to say the dominant colour(s) look best in first or fourth position.
I've undone the 9 squares and managed to replace a strip so my dominant colour is first and am now really happy with the block.
